I am a mac user of about 1 year. I have a Macbook Pro as my computer at work. I was thinking about trading a guitar I have for an apple computer for my personal use. I have been offered 2 and am trying to decide which one, if either, would be suitable. My guitar has a value of $400-500.

Here is what I was offered:

Powerbook G4 Titanium, 15.4" LCD, 867mhz CPU, 30 GB HDD, CD-RW/DVD combo drive, 1GB RAM, Airport Card, OS X 10.3.9, Cosmetically 7 out of 10

OR

iBook G3, 14", 800mhz CPU, 30 GB HDD, 640 MB RAM, Airport Card, OS X 10.2.8, CD-RW/DVD combo drive, Cosmetically 9 out of 10.

Is either of these machines worth $400-500? If so, would it be better to take a PB in worse shape or an almost perfect iBook that is a little slower.

How important is screen resolution to you? The iBook has a smaller screen, and IIRC only goes to 1024x768, plus driving an external monitor is a pain.

The Powerbook has more RAM, so that will make a difference, plus I'm pretty sure the PB will have the wide screen.

Unless portability are more important to you (which it might, iBooks a real small for their vintage) I'd go with the Powerbook all things being (un)equal.
